Unfortunately not on the NW side of town, but there is one on Tuesday afternoon 3-7 on Rice in the stadium parking lot, and the same team at T'Afia Restaurant Saturday morning 8-noon.

The Wild Wild West in the Pecan Grove area is very near me but I didn't mention it because it is hardly worth visiting. And certainly not from NW Houston, lol. There are only about 4 booths, one sells soaps, the other sells oils every other week, another sells bakery goods and the 4th sells herbs. It has a long way to go before it is a true FM.

It it set up inside a garden decor store and I'm afraid the owner is asking too much rental for the booths. I'm only speculating here.
